Position Summary:
The Quality and Regulatory Compliance Specialist is responsible for ensuring that development processes for all in vitro diagnostic (IVD) products comply with applicable regulatory requirements and quality standards. This role will work closely with cross-functional teams to support product development, manufacturing, and post-market activities. The specialist will ensure that all documentation and files related to diagnostic development are completed in a timely manner and are ready for inspections.
Key Responsibilities:
-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ements for In Vitro Diagnostic products, FDA 21 CFR Part 820, ISO 13485.
- Provide regulatory guidance during the product development process, ensuring that products are designed and developed in compliance with applicable regulations.
- Participate in risk management activities, including the development and maintenance of risk management files according to ISO 14971 and FDA 21 CFR Part 820.
- Conduct risk assessments and work with product development teams to mitigate identified risks.
- Participate in design reviews meetings and validation activities, ensuring that regulatory and quality requirements are met.
- Review and approve design control documentation, including design input and output, design verification and validation protocols, ensuring that all documentation meets regulatory requirements.
- Review and approve design history file for each new product.
- Support preparation of internal quality and regulatory documents in support of regulatory submission (De Novo and 510K) for IVD products.
